What Safety Features Do Modern Lithium Golf Cart Batteries Include?
Advanced models incorporate seven-layer protection:
1. Cell-level fuses
2. Overvoltage cutoff (82V max)
3. Undervoltage protection (58V min)
4. Short-circuit shutdown (<0.01s response)
5. Temperature sensors (3-5 per pack)
6. Current balancing (±1% variance)
7. IP67 waterproof casing
Cell-level fusing prevents catastrophic failures by isolating damaged cells while maintaining 85%+ pack functionality. The multi-stage voltage protection system works in tandem with smart chargers to prevent overcharging during regenerative braking scenarios. Premium models feature redundant temperature monitoring with 5-7 sensors per battery pack, enabling precise thermal mapping and 30% faster cooling response compared to basic designs.
IP67-rated enclosures protect against dust ingress and temporary submersion in 3 feet of water for 30 minutes – critical for golf carts navigating wet fairways or beach terrain. Recent innovations include self-testing protocols where the BMS automatically runs diagnostic checks every 15 charge cycles, generating maintenance reports via Bluetooth connectivity.

How Do Lithium Batteries Compare to Traditional Lead-Acid?
Lithium provides 3× deeper discharge (100% vs 50% DoD) and 5× faster charging. Energy density reaches 150-200Wh/kg versus 30-50Wh/kg for lead-acid. Total cost of ownership is 40% lower over 10 years despite higher upfront costs ($2,500 vs $1,200).
Feature | Lithium | Lead-Acid |
---|---|---|
Cycle Life | 6,000+ | 800-1,200 |
Charge Time | 4-6 hours | 8-10 hours |
Weight | 68-75 lbs | 130+ lbs |
Operational advantages become apparent in hilly terrain where lithium maintains consistent voltage output, preserving 98% torque capacity versus lead-acid’s 20-30% voltage sag. Environmental factors further differentiate the technologies – lithium batteries contain no liquid electrolytes and are 95% recyclable compared to lead-acid’s 80% recycling rate with hazardous lead content.
What Maintenance Extends Lithium Battery Lifespan?
Key practices include:
• Store at 50% charge when inactive
• Avoid full discharges below 20%
• Use compatible 72V lithium chargers
• Clean terminals quarterly
• Balance cells every 500 cycles
• Update BMS firmware annually
Storage protocols require maintaining batteries in climate-controlled environments (50-77°F ideal) with <60% humidity. Terminal cleaning should involve non-conductive brushes and dielectric grease application to prevent corrosion. Advanced users can access balancing mode through manufacturer apps, redistributing charge between cells within 0.5% variance – a process taking 2-4 hours depending on pack condition.

FAQ
- Q: Can I retrofit lithium batteries in older golf carts?
- A: Yes, but requires voltage regulator adjustment and compatible charger replacement.
- Q: What warranty comes with premium batteries?
- A: Leading brands offer 5-8 year warranties covering 70%+ capacity retention.
- Q: How to calculate real-world range?
- A: Multiply voltage (72V) by capacity (100Ah) for 7.2kWh. Divide by 100Wh/mile = 72 miles theoretical range.
